Subject: Catalogue import cut-over — wrapped up

Hi! Quick summary for the release notes: the Thornfield catalogue import moved onto the new Bindery pipeline last night. All 400k records landed cleanly, dedupe caught about 1,200 stale entries, and the old importer is now read-only. One small wrinkle — the MARC field mapper needed a hotfix around midnight, already merged. For the release record, the pipeline ran with the configuration values below.

deployment values, faduf-tawep:
SORDOR_LOG_LEVEL=error
SORDOR_METRICS_HOST=metrics.sordor.nelvrolabs.internal
SORDOR_POOL_SIZE=4

## Releases

Quick note for the sync: the nightly search reindex on Mossgate now ships as its own release artifact instead of piggybacking on the API deploy. It runs at 01:30, takes ~20 minutes, and rolls back automatically on checksum mismatch. Artifacts must be signed before the runner will touch them. The key we sign reindex artifacts with is below.

release key, bagep-yajof: bky19_xtqFhCW5hRYj5CXT2ZJ

Subject: Inventory write-down — Q3

Branch managers: Torvane Outfitters will write down 1.8m of slow-moving Ridgeline stock this quarter. Clearance pricing starts Monday; no further reorders on affected lines. Margin impact lands centrally, not on branch P&Ls. Questions to regional finance. The decision connects to next year's range strategy, summarised below.

management briefing: Project Ulavan slips by two quarters because of the staffing delay.

## v2.8.1 — Key rotation

Heads up, future maintainers: we rotated the signing key for Huemark, our color-contrast accessibility audit tool. The old key was nearing expiry and we wanted it swapped before the big Q3 audit run. All audit report bundles from this version onward are signed with the new key; older reports still verify against the archived one (see the vault notes). CI was updated, local verify scripts were not — fix yours manually. The new key, for reference, is:

rollout seal: bky4_x7Gc